    This article takes the form of a feedback on the setting up of European research projects, unfolding the sequences between objectives, constraints and decision-making for two concrete cases. It shows how the actors of these projects – scholars and engineers – try to elaborate a scientific, documentary, technological and ethical answer to the requirements of the European Commission in terms of research data management, at a time when these requirements do not correspond to professions and practices integrated into the research structures, nor to routines or needs identified among the research teams. It advocates the joint consideration between researchers and engineers of the ethical issues related to data management as soon as projects are set up.
